The difficulty doesn't come from the math equation. It's comes from the fact they hash through the sha-256 algorithm and therefore don't know the outcome of the equation.

Miners construct a new block by collecting transactions from the mempool and creating a block header containing data like the previous block hash, merkle root, timestamp, and a nonce (initially set to 0).

This block is then hashed using the SHA-256 hashing algorithm, giving a seemingly random output. This output has to be lower than the target output set out by the btc network. If it isn't, the miners will increase the nonce by 1 and run the algorithm again.

The processing power usage comes from trying to perform this algorithm as fast as possible and as many times as possible so they can find the answer first. Due to the SHA-256 randomness, it's essentially a lucky dip each time. The more go's, the more likely the miner will be successful.
